Yes, vinegar can remove cloudiness from glass. Mix equal parts of white vinegar and water, apply the solution to the glass, and scrub gently with a soft cloth. Rinse thoroughly for a sparkling finish.

FAQs & Answers

  1. How does vinegar remove cloudiness from glass? Vinegar is acidic and helps dissolve mineral deposits and residue that cause cloudiness on glass surfaces, restoring clarity.
  2. Can I use vinegar on all types of glass? While vinegar is safe for most glass surfaces, avoid using it on tinted or coated glass as it may damage the finish.
  3. Are there alternatives to vinegar for cleaning cloudy glass? Yes, alternatives like baking soda paste or commercial glass cleaners can also help remove cloudiness effectively.
